Check with your current webhosting provider if your server is PHP and MYSQL databases capable. Then you can download the forum for free:
PHPbb (free): http://www.phpbb.com
Invision board (licensed): http://www.invisionboard.com
If you are thinking of simple and easy to use forum, phpbb is good for you.
Are you using Cpanel for your control panel?
Cpanel fantastico has all preinstalled scripts ready for you to self-download to your server.
